Autoethnography in Therapy: Exploring Therapist Emotions in Work with Self Injury Joanna Naxton
Autoethnography in Therapy: Exploring Therapist Emotions in Work with Self Injury
Joanna Naxton
This evocative autoethnography offers an intimate exploration of the emotional life of therapists working with clients who self-injure. Blending personal narrative with theory, it confronts the often-hidden world of therapeutic practice – fear, shame, anger, voyeuristic impulses, and a persistent undercurrent of existential anxiety.
